from pacman.data import PacmanDataView
from pacman.model.resources.abstract_sdram import AbstractSDRAM
class ChipCounter(object):
"""
A counter of how many chips are needed to hold machine vertices.
This does not look at the fixed_locations of the vertices at all.
The value produced will be a (hopefully) worst-case estimate and should
not be used to decide failure in terms of space!
"""
__slots__ = (
# How many cores there are to be used on a chip
"__n_cores_per_chip",
# How much SDRAM there is to be used on a chip
"__sdram_per_chip",
# The number of cores free on the "current" chip
"__cores_free",
# The SDRAM free on the "current" chip
"__sdram_free",
# The number of chips used, including the current one
"__n_chips")
def __init__(self) -> None:
version = PacmanDataView.get_machine_version()
self.__n_cores_per_chip = (
version.max_cores_per_chip - version.n_scamp_cores -
PacmanDataView.get_all_monitor_cores())
self.__sdram_per_chip = (
version.max_sdram_per_chip -
PacmanDataView.get_all_monitor_sdram().get_total_sdram(
PacmanDataView().get_plan_n_timestep()))
self.__cores_free = 0
self.__sdram_free = 0
self.__n_chips = 0

def add_core(self, resources: AbstractSDRAM) -> None:
"""
Adds a core (or if needed a Chip) to the count
:param AbstractSDRAM resources:
"""
sdram = resources.get_total_sdram(
PacmanDataView.get_plan_n_timestep())
if self.__cores_free == 0 or self.__sdram_free < sdram:
self.__n_chips += 1
self.__cores_free = self.__n_cores_per_chip
self.__sdram_free = self.__sdram_per_chip
self.__cores_free -= 1
self.__sdram_free -= sdram
@property
def n_chips(self) -> int:
"""
:rtype: int
"""
return self.__n_chips
